ADR-037 — The bootstrap-family capability table bounds which command may write which path class

Status: Proposed (2026-07-21) Date: 2026-07-21 Related: ADR-038, ADR-039 Decision: the semver-trust binary gains an environment-tooling command family (doctor, enroll, setup) whose write authority is fixed by a capability table, and no command may write outside its cell:

Widening any cell — a new writable path class, or a command that writes a class it does not today — requires a superseding ADR. The trust boundary the family never crosses is the human-signed commit through the meta-path gate: no command stages, commits, or signs, so generated material becomes trusted only through a person’s reviewed, signed commit. Rationale: the family adds mutation to a binary that was previously verification-only, so the capability surface must be enumerable and frozen rather than growing feature by feature. A fixed table lets verify/doctor be provably write-free — the property an agent-safe diagnostic needs — and forces the next convenience feature to argue its case by superseding this decision rather than quietly appending a write path. The steelman’s sharpest hit, that a verifier which also writes becomes a mutation engine that attests its own output, is answered here: the only bytes a command writes land unstaged in the working tree or in repo-local git config, and neither enters history except through the meta-path-gated signed commit. Rejected: letting each command define its own write scope ad hoc (no enforceable boundary, scope creep by default); a hook installer that writes executable code run on every commit (a genuine capability escalation — cut in favor of a committed hook script plus a printed core.hooksPath line); a single do-everything command whose generated founding material is never forced through human eyes. Revisit trigger: a concrete bootstrap or diagnosis need that no cell in the table can serve read-only, at which point the widening is made explicit by a superseding ADR, not a flag.
